WebApr 1, 2011 · In both birds, the pancreas is located on the right side of the abdomen between the ascending and descending loops of the duodenum. The pancreas of the Japanese quail composed of dorsal, ventral ... WebThe pancreas of birds is composed of three lobes, a dorsal, a ventral and a splenic lobe. It consists of an exocrine and an endocrine part. The islets of Langerhans of the endocrine pancreas are more numerous in …
